The conflict arose when the eventual buyer requested that the listing agent represent them as well. In California, while dual agency is permitted under specific circumstances, it can often create a perceived or actual conflict of interest where a seller’s fiduciary priority is diluted. The seller required a representative who would prioritize their interests 100% and refuse to compromise her negotiating leverage for the sake of a double-sided commission.

Fiduciary Duty & Dual Agency: Under California Civil Code § 2079.13, a real estate agent must disclose their agency relationship. While dual agency is legal, I recommend sellers carefully consider if they prefer “exclusive representation” to ensure their agent’s loyalty is not divided.
